Comedy Store Uganda proprietor, Alex Muhangi, has spoken out about his disappointment after Bebe Cool failed to perform at the Comedy Store show last Wednesday.

Muhangi, who was emotional during a TikTok live, questioned how someone he has known for years and considers a close friend could let him down in such a manner.

“Comedy Store has given Bebe Cool more than UGX 100 million. He was booked for the show, and I paid him my money. Bebe Cool is a big artist, but in this situation, I was the client, and I will not lose my position as a client.”

He further criticized Bebe Cool for promoting his new song Motivation instead of honoring his commitment. “How do you talk about ‘Motivation’ and then reach the parking lot of a show with 800 people waiting for you, hosted by your own friend, and leave without performing?” he questioned.

Muhangi reiterated that his disappointment was not about the money but rather the principle of respect and professionalism. “It hurts me that rasta came to my show and did not perform. He is my boy, and I have known him for a long time. This is not about money; it’s because rasta wanted to promote his song Motivation.”

Despite his frustration, Muhangi did not indicate any plans to sever ties with Bebe Cool.
